Seed #: | 218 |
Variety: | Culinary |
Colour: | Herb |
Temperature (C): | 16 - 22 |
Zone: | 2+ |
Blooms: | July to September |
Site: | Full Sun |
Quantity: | 25 |
Height (cm): | 60 - 80 |
Spread (cm): | 30 - 60 |
Seed Details:
Attractive, drought-tolerant and produces unique purple flowers. Use for flavouring meat, soups, stews, salads and stuffing. Prune early in Spring to help keep plants bushy. Highly aromatic and may be used as a gargle to aid in soothing inflammation of the nose and throat. Easy to grow.
Instructions:
Direct seed 2 mm deep. Germinates 10 to 12 days.
Habitat:
Sage works well with many herbs, but avoid planting next to onions.
History:
In the early Middle, Ages Sage was commonly cultivated in monastery gardens for its benefits of healing many human ailments
Historic Uses:
The ancient Greeks and Romans first used sage as a meat preservative. They also believe it could enhance memory snakebites, increase a woman's fertility, and more. Dioscorides and Pliny recommended sage as a diuretic and tonic.
